How You’ll Make an Impact
As an Improvement Engineer
, you’ll be at the forefront of our innovation, responsible for implementing process and technology improvement opportunities within your technology area. This includes leading teams that evaluate improvements from the opportunity list for possible implementation and working with technology experts (Centers of Excellence) to collect data required to complete scope definition for improvement projects and activities.
- Possess in-depth process technology and continuous improvement skill sets helping to establish credibility with the operations team.
- Lead continuous improvement activities (gap closure and project scope definition) for the unit and serve in specific project-related roles as the manufacturing representative through Front-End Loading (FEL) design.
- Partner with experts (Centers of Excellence, Operations, Environmental Health & Safety) to develop project scope and gap closure plans that support business objectives.
- Analyze production loss accounting data to develop and prioritize a list of process improvement opportunities.
- Champion process safety activities in project design and partner with Operations to ensure a robust, safe manufacturing process.
- Ensure implementation of the most effective technology by integrating operability input from Operations, corporate and business Manufacturing Engineering Technology, and Maintenance and Reliability into project definition and design.
- Carry accountability for the technical integrity and operability of the units supported.
- Ensure effective interface between the manufacturing representative and plant operations to ensure technical integrity and optimum operability.
- Provide effective communication and coordination between project teams and Operations.
- Support project Front-End Loading activities as required.
- Serve as the lead person for all new plant product trials.
